Project: PREDICT
Location: Andes
As part of the PREDICT project to understand the precise amount of precipitation in the tropical mountain forests of the Andes a NES210 Eigenbrodt Fog Collector was used to evaluate the characteristics of six manual quadratic polypropylene mesh collectors.
Also deployed was a BIRAL VPF-730 forwardscatter meter to measure the atmospheric extinction and horizontal visibility, rain rate, particle number, droplet spectra and rain type. In a field campaign from December 2001 to April 2003 additional measurements of vertical rainfall profiles were performed with the METEK Micro Rain Radar.

Project: MED POL study
Location: Mediterranean region
As part of the MED POL airborne pollution monitoring and modelling programme the Eigenbrodt Model NSA181 wet-only rain sampler was deployed in Turkey, at a met station 50 km from Ankara.

Project: The Dutch National Air Quality Monitoring Network (LML in Dutch)
Location: Netherlands
During the LML project the Eigenbrodt Model NSA181 wet-only rain sampler was deployed for the sampling of precipitation to determine:
degree of acidity (pH)
conductivity at 25 oC
strong acid (H)
ammonium (NH4)
sodium ( Na))
magnesium (Mg)
calcium(Ca)
potassium (K)
chloride (Cl)
sulphate (SO4)
nitrate (NO3)
whilst the Eigenbrodt UNS120 was used for the sampling and determination of mercury.

Project: Musk compounds in the Nordic environment
Location: Scandinavia
For this project it was recommended that the rain water samples were taken with a cooled wet-only sampler like the Eigenbrodt NSA181/KE with a funnel area of about 500 cm2. Otherwise the sampling laboratory has to insure that the sample temperature does not exceed 4 °C, the sample is kept protected against UV-light and that no dry deposition takes place.
Project: SYCON (Synthesis and New Concept for North Sea Research)
The research project SYCON had the objective of summarising and evaluating the current knowledge on the North Sea. For this purpose ten working groups were established. An Eigenbrodt precipitation collector was deployed as well as a Metek ultrasonic anemometer for ship board turbulence studies.
